A BILL
To name the Department of Veterans Affairs outpatient clinic in
Horsham, Pennsylvania, as the ``Victor J. Saracini Department of
Veterans Affairs Outpatient Clinic''.
Be it enacted by the Senate and House of Representatives of the
United States of America in Congress assembled,
SECTION 1. FINDINGS.
Congress finds the following:
(1) Victor J. Saracini was an esteemed, decorated officer
with the United States Navy, ending his military career in the
Naval Reserve at Naval Air Station Willow Grove, Pennsylvania.
(2) Joining United Airlines in 1985, Mr. Saracini worked
his way up the ranks to captain of the United Airline's Boeing
757-767 fleet.
(3) Victor Saracini was the captain of United Airlines
Flight 175, one of the four commercial jets hijacked by
terrorists on September 11, 2001.
(4) At 9:05 a.m., the Los Angeles-bound airplane flew into
the South Tower of the World Trade Center, killing all people
onboard, including Captain Victor Saracini.
(5) On September 11, 2001, the United States lost Victor
Saracini, a devoted aviator, a distinguished veteran, and a
proud defender of America's freedom.
SEC. 2. NAME OF DEPARTMENT OF VETERAN AFFAIRS OUTPATIENT CLINIC,
HORSHAM, PENNSYLVANIA.
The Department of Veterans Affairs outpatient clinic located in
Horsham, Pennsylvania, shall after the date of the enactment of this
Act be known and designated as the ``Victor J. Saracini Department of
Veterans Affairs Outpatient Clinic''. Any reference to such outpatient
clinic in any law, regulation, map, document, record, or other paper of
the United States shall be considered to be a reference to the Victor
J. Saracini Department of Veterans Affairs Outpatient Clinic.
